def test_coeval_vs_low_level(ic):

    coeval = wrapper.run_coeval(
        redshift=20,
        init_box=ic,
        zprime_step_factor=1.1,
        regenerate=True,
        flag_options={"USE_TS_FLUCT": True},
        write=False,
    )

    st = wrapper.spin_temperature(
        redshift=20,
        init_boxes=ic,
        zprime_step_factor=1.1,
        regenerate=True,
        flag_options={"USE_TS_FLUCT": True},
        write=False,
    )

    assert np.allclose(coeval.Tk_box, st.Tk_box)
    assert np.allclose(coeval.Ts_box, st.Ts_box)
    assert np.allclose(coeval.x_e_box, st.x_e_box)
